Get the Benefits of an Illinois Group Health Insurance Plan

Health insurance available to individuals is generally much more expensive and offers less coverage than health care insurance found in group plans. But if you are self-employed or your group coverage ends, what alternatives do you have to get the health coverage you might need? Fortunately, there is an organization designed to help you with this very dilemma, and membership in the group includes access to quality group health insurance.

Health Insurance

Health Insurance

The group was formed as FACT (the Federation of American Consumers and Travelers) and offers at least twenty different benefits and plans to its group members. By joining FACT more than a million consumers have found quality and affordable group health, and dental insurance, prescription drug coverage, or eye care and hearing services. FACT offers several health insurance programs from one state to another, including HMOs and PPOs and available in all levels of co-payments and annual deductibles. All health insurance plans provided by FACT are made available and underwritten by qualified insurance companies who have an A. M. Best rating of "A" or more.

The FACT group coverage policies include other health services such as prescription drugs discount plans, dental plans, eye care services, and hearing services. A number of these plans offer negotiated rates with approved health care providers for excellent consumer value.
